Common Types of Obstetrical Mistakes

Obstetrical mistakes include any errors, intentional or not, that were made during a pregnancy, delivery, or after childbirth that may cause a mother or child to suffer an injury or defect as a result. Some of the most common types of mistakes include:

  • Failure to recognize maternal infections
  • Failure to recognize or treat maternal/fetal distress
  • Failure to perform a timely cesarean section
  • Failure to diagnose or treat jaundice, meningitis, or seizure disorders
  • Improper use of delivery tools (vacuum extraction and forceps)

Obstetrical mistakes often result in injury to the baby including brain damage, Erb’s palsy, cerebral palsy, and even death. In some instances, an obstetrical mistake can cause maternal death.
